I applied via Naukri.com and was interviewed in Mar 2022. There were 2 interview rounds.

Round 1 - Aptitude Test 

Basis English, math, reasoning test plz prepare properly.

Round 2 - One-on-one 

(5 Questions)

  • Q1. What do you mean by trade life cycle
  • Ans. 

    Trade life cycle refers to the stages involved in a trade from initiation to settlement.

    • Trade initiation

    • Order execution

    • Trade confirmation

    • Clearing and settlement

    • Trade reconciliation

    • Post-trade activities

    • Examples: equity trade, bond trade, foreign exchange trade

  • Q2. What do you mean by derivatives
  • Ans. 

    Derivatives are financial contracts whose value is derived from an underlying asset or security.

    • Derivatives can be used for hedging or speculation.

    • Examples include futures, options, swaps, and forwards.

    • Derivatives can be traded on exchanges or over-the-counter.

    • Derivatives can be complex and carry significant risk.

    • Derivatives played a role in the 2008 financial crisis.

  • Q1. What is autocorrelation?
  • Ans. 

    Autocorrelation is the correlation of a signal with a delayed copy of itself.

    • Autocorrelation is used to identify patterns in time series data.

    • It is a measure of how similar a signal is to a delayed version of itself.

    • Autocorrelation can be positive, negative, or zero.

    • It is commonly used in signal processing, finance, and econometrics.

    • Autocorrelation can be visualized using a correlogram.

  • Q2. What is heteroscedasticity?
  • Ans. 

    Heteroscedasticity is a statistical term that refers to the unequal variance of a variable across different levels of another variable.

    • It is a violation of the assumption of homoscedasticity in regression analysis.

    • It can lead to biased and inefficient estimates of regression coefficients.

    • It can be detected through residual plots or statistical tests such as the Breusch-Pagan test.

eClerx Interview FAQs

How many rounds are there in eClerx Business Analyst interview for experienced candidates?
eClerx interview process for experienced candidates usually has 2 rounds. The most common rounds in the eClerx interview process for experienced candidates are Aptitude Test and One-on-one Round.
How to prepare for eClerx Business Analyst interview for experienced candidates?
Go through your CV in detail and study all the technologies mentioned in your CV. Prepare at least two technologies or languages in depth if you are appearing for a technical interview at eClerx. The most common topics and skills that interviewers at eClerx expect are Business Analysis, Database Design, Application Development, Data Analysis and Business Intelligence.
